Best Games Across All Platforms: An Evolution of Gaming Excellence

The gaming industry has seen tremendous growth over the years, evolving from pixelated block graphics to photorealistic visuals. As the medium expanded, some games stood out as the best examples of what gaming could achieve. The phrase “best games” often refers to titles that push boundaries, whether through immersive storytelling, innovative mechanics, or revolutionary graphics. Some of the most renowned games of all time fall into this category, shaping the course of gaming history. These games offer an experience beyond the conventional, blending art and entertainment seamlessly.

For example, The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t has been a game-changer for open-world RPGs. This massive role-playing game set in a beautifully detailed fantasy world is not only known for its engaging story but also for its deep side quests that often feel slot gacor maxwin as important as the main narrative. The game’s ability to make players emotionally invested in characters, regardless of their small part in the overall plot, was revolutionary. The character of Geralt of Rivia has become a cultural icon, and the game itself has set a standard for open-world storytelling that many other titles strive to meet.

Red Dead Redemption 2, another game widely considered one of the best of its generation, is a masterclass in world-building. Rockstar Games took open-world gaming to a new level with the expansive and alive world of the American frontier. Players experience the life of Arthur Morgan and his gang in ways that feel authentic, detailed, and genuinely immersive. The world itself feels like a living, breathing entity, with characters, animals, and environmental storytelling all working together to make the setting as real as possible. Few games have captured the essence of a time period and the raw emotions of its characters in such an unforgettable way.

Lastly, The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ild has fundamentally changed how players think about exploration in open-world games. Unlike many games that fill their maps with markers and objectives, Breath of the Wild gives players the freedom to explore the vast world without feeling constrained. The lack of hand-holding allows for personal discovery, making every mountain climb or new location feel earned. The game’s physics engine, which allows for creativity in solving problems, and its open-ended approach to combat and puzzle-solving are just a few reasons why it is considered one of the best games ever made.

These titles are just a few examples of the best games that have redefined what is possible in the world of gaming. Each of them pushes boundaries in their own way, whether through narrative depth, world-building, or freedom of exploration. The landscape of gaming is continually changing, but these masterpieces will be remembered for years to come as the gold standard of what the best games can achieve.

    PlayStation’s Portable Revolution: The Best PSP Games That Defined a Generation

    The PlayStation Portable wasn’t just Sony’s answer to handheld YOKAISLOT gaming—it was a revolution in how players experienced PlayStation games outside of the living room. While many expected the PSP to deliver diluted versions of console games, it shattered those expectations by offering some of the best games available on any platform at the time. With a powerful hardware architecture and a sleek interface, the PSP was positioned to redefine mobile entertainment, and its impact is still felt today.

    Titles like Metal Gear Solid: Peace Walker exemplified just how ambitious PSP games could be. With a rich narrative, deep customization mechanics, and strategic gameplay, it became more than a companion piece to the console series—it was a full-fledged PlayStation game that pushed boundaries. Similarly, God of War: Chains of Olympus brought Kratos’ signature rage to a smaller screen without compromising on the cinematic quality that made the franchise so iconic. These games were not just handheld marvels; they were milestones in PlayStation history.

    The PSP’s game library also showcased diversity and creativity. From the rhythm-based madness of Patapon to the vibrant world of LocoRoco, developers took advantage of the PSP’s unique capabilities to build innovative titles that couldn’t be found on traditional consoles. This creative surge made the system a haven for gamers seeking fresh experiences. In many ways, these titles laid the groundwork for PlayStation’s future openness to indie developers and experimental gameplay in later console generations.

    Beyond the games themselves, the PSP symbolized freedom for PlayStation fans. Players no longer had to be tethered to a console to enjoy their favorite franchises or discover new ones. The best PSP games provided deep, immersive experiences that mirrored the quality of their console counterparts. This level of portability and quality was unprecedented at the time and has only been rivaled in recent years by hybrid consoles.

    The PSP was more than just a handheld—it was a bridge between console-grade storytelling and on-the-go convenience. Its best games were often on par with, and sometimes better than, their home-console siblings. As the gaming industry continues to evolve, the legacy of PSP games lives on, reminding us that great experiences don’t need to be confined to one type of screen.

    Epic Journeys and Pocket Adventures: Exploring the Best of PlayStation and PSP Games

    Gaming is about exploration, growth, and unforgettable moments—and few platforms offer those better than PlayStation and the PSP. Over the years, both systems slot resmi have hosted titles that pushed boundaries, introduced new ideas, and earned their places among the best games ever created. From the grand cinematic narratives of console titles to the innovative and accessible design of PSP games, Sony has cultivated a library that speaks to casual players and hardcore gamers alike. These games define what makes PlayStation a household name in the gaming world.

    PlayStation games are widely recognized for their technical excellence and narrative depth. Franchises like “God of War,” “Ratchet & Clank,” and “The Last of Us” are more than just hits—they’re cultural landmarks. The way these games combine breathtaking visuals, fluid mechanics, and powerful storytelling places them among the best in the world. Sony’s first-party studios continue to push creative limits, whether through unique mechanics like time manipulation in “Returnal” or the stealth-action blend of “Spider-Man 2.” Each new PlayStation generation seems to elevate the quality of games to previously unthinkable heights.

    But the PSP wasn’t simply a “console-lite” experience. It stood tall as its own unique platform with a robust library of games that felt full and satisfying. PSP games such as “Resistance: Retribution,” “Lumines,” and “Final Fantasy Type-0” were designed specifically to leverage the device’s power and portability. The PSP became a gateway for gamers to enjoy console-caliber experiences on buses, in waiting rooms, or during lunch breaks. It was a system built for flexibility but with no compromise on fun. The best games on PSP weren’t just good—they were tailored perfectly for mobile immersion.

    The shared DNA between PlayStation and PSP is their emphasis on quality and innovation. Both platforms delivered content that shaped player expectations and influenced game design across the industry. Even now, many PSP games are being ported, emulated, or referenced in modern titles, showing how impactful their ideas were. PlayStation games remain at the forefront of the industry, leading the charge with groundbreaking titles each year. Together, these platforms have created a legacy of best games that gamers return to time and again. From epic console journeys to smart, compact adventures, Sony has left an undeniable mark on the world of gaming.
